We're Materialistic, a specialty fabric house providing green and blue screens, backdrops, drapery, technical fabrics and custom soft goods for films, television, and various entertainment industries. Production Assistant (Fabric and Sewing) Your days will be full of variety since our clients have various needs, both made to order and maintenance sewing projects. This work will always keep you moving. You'll be working closely with the team for the first few months to fulfill regular and custom client orders while familiarizing yourself with our products, materials, warehouse layout and best practices. Your experience with fabrics and sewing will be your head start on what you'll learn here. Practically speaking you will: * Sew with industrial machines * Handle custom manufacturing requests * Track projects and maintain inventory database * Draft patterns for a range of projects * Assess returned products and fabrics * Clean, as well as repair screens & materials The best person in this role is organized, can work independently, take initiative, bring new ideas to the table, and follow up on deliverables. Working at Materialistic This is a full-time permanent position, offering $17.20-$19 per hour, commensurate with experience, plus vacation, overtime and benefits. You'll work Monday to Friday in our sunlit warehouse in Etobicoke, from 9:00-5:00pm, with flexibility as needed. We're a small company doing elite work. You'll work closely with the owner, who has over 25 years in the entertainment industries. This is your chance to become an expert in fabrics and their role in film productions.
